I would not use dirt only because you never know if some one has used toxic chemicals such as pesticides. These chemicals can really do damage to a snake and then you can end up either with a expensive vet bill or a dead snake. It would be best if you were to buy a substrate at a pet shop that has been treated and is safe for your pet.
